1.) Apples to oranges, you are comparing PvP Paladin to normal Paladin, which are vastly different beasts.
2.) You provide the longest duration stun and are extremely tanky. You provide suitable annoyance factor on maps with interactable nodes (Onsal Hakair, Seal Rock). Your Limit Break is an absolute game changer against enemy limit breaks being used by reducing a ton of damage. You can cover teammates to help them get out or use it slingshot yourself into safety of another. You don't have the same offensive power as say Warrior, Gunbreaker or Dark Knight, but you are by no right a bad job pick.
